This biophysics course introduces fundamental physical principles essential for understanding biological systems and veterinary medical technologies. It covers the behavior of light, including image formation through lenses and mirrors, which is important for instruments like microscopes and ophthalmoscopes. The course also presents the nature of electromagnetic radiation, its interaction with matter, and its biological effects, including applications such as X-rays and diagnostic imaging in animals. Students learn the principles of fluid mechanics, including pressure, flow, viscosity, and circulation, which are applied to understand blood flow, respiration, and other fluid-related processes in animals. Finally, the course explores sound waves, their propagation, and properties, as well as ultrasound principles used in veterinary diagnostics, such as organ examination and pregnancy monitoring.
